NBC, CBS, FOX split up not very large pie

Fast National ratings for Friday, Feb. 1, 2008

The stakes weren't especially high in Friday's TV ratings, but the race turned out to be an awfully close one.

NBC, CBS and FOX all posted a 4.4 rating/8 share among households for the night, and the total-viewer numbers were nearly a dead-heat as well: NBC led with 6.79 million viewers, followed by FOX, 6.71 million, and CBS, 6.7 million. ABC came in fourth with a 3.4/6, and The CW earned a 2.8/5.

There was a tie for the lead among adults 18-49 as well -- NBC and FOX both averaged a 2.0 rating. CBS was next at 1.6, and ABC and The CW tied at 1.4.

NBC's "1 vs. 100" led the 8 p.m. hour with a 5.1/9. A "Ghost Whisperer" rerun, 4.7/8, put CBS in second, while FOX's "Bones" was third at 3.7/6. A "Grey's Anatomy" repeat on ABC took fourth in households, but "Friday Night Smackdown!," 2.7/5, brought a few more total viewers to The CW.

A "House" repeat, 5.1/8, moved FOX to the top spot at 9 p.m. CBS' "Moonlight," 3.9/7, beat out NBC's "Friday Night Lights," 3.7/6, for second. "Smackdown!" improved by a couple tenths of a point to keep The CW ahead of ABC and "Desperate Housewives," 2.5/4.

At 10 p.m., ABC's "20/20" led in households with a 4.7/8, but CBS' "Numb3rs," 4.6/8, and NBC's "Las Vegas," 4.5/8, had more total viewers.

  • Ratings information is taken from fast national data, which includes live and same-day DVR viewing. All numbers are preliminary and subject to change.
